The idea
An island, a map, and a number of digs that is always one fewer than you'd like. Every hole you open tells you something about where the next one should go — warmer, colder, or nothing at all, which is its own kind of information.
The one decision
Open the chest you found, or spend your last digs looking for the bigger one you think is out there. The first chest is always real. The bigger one is not always.
What has to be true before it ships
- A round has to fit in the time it takes to drink a coffee.
- Losing has to feel like a bad read, never like a coin flip.
- Two players with the same map have to be able to argue about it.
